3-day Guided Riverland Eco-Adventure Tour
Set on Australia's greatest river, this 3-day guided eco-adventure tour showcases the natural environment and diverse wildlife of the Riverland, with over 180 different bird species, kangaroos, emus, spectacular forests and ochre-coloured cliffs. Your tour includes walks with an Aboriginal ranger, canoeing along the tranquil backwaters of the river Murray, and a drive through dunes and lake for bird-watching.
The houseboat is your lodge style accommodation which is moored in a spectacular location opposite Headings Cliffs. The view from your bedroom window frames amazing scenery and river mists early in the morning. In the evenings, relax in the houseboat lounge and share stories with your fellow travellers as your guides prepare mouthwatering meals, or take a seat on the riverbank under starry skies around the camp fire.
The houseboat lodge include 5 bedrooms (each room sleeps 2 people), 2 bathrooms with hot showers, a spacious lounge, a modern kitchen and a top deck area with hot spa and spectacular views. Each day the houseboat moves along the river to your walking destination for the day.
Operating in such a delicate environment, houseboats are the perfect accommodation for maintaining a low impact activity on the river system. A ‘leave no trace’ approach is maintained and all waste is taken onshore to be composted, recycled or disposed of appropriately.

Renmark to Headings Cliffs
Meet the team in Renmark, leave your car secure and you will be transfered by bus to your houseboat accommodation. En route we stop at Headings Cliffs overlooking the spectacular landscapes of the Murray River and the places we will explore over the next three days. Board your houseboat and enjoy lunch while cruising through dense red gum forests to our overnight mooring, spotting river birds along the way. Now you are ready to join the Aboriginal Rangers on Calperum Station for an afternoon discovering this amazing culture, returning to your houseboat for pre-dinner nibbles around the campfire. Nocturnal walking and stargazing the night skies await after dinner.
Sunrise birdwatching and canoeing
Awake early and board a minibus for sunrise on Lake Merreti where spectacular birdwatching can include Pied Stilts, Red-necked Avocets, Yellow-billed Spoonbills, migratory waders and ducks, and emus and kangaroos visiting the shoreline. Harriers and Whistling Kites will be busy in this area and an occasional Wedge-tailed Eagle may visit. Enjoy morning tea on the lake before we journey into the mallee dune country that surrounds the floodplain, home of the Mallee Fowl. We return to our houseboat for lunch and an afternoon siesta. Rested, we cruise to the start of a guided canoe route through the Woolenook Bend backwaters before cruising on twilight back to our houseboat where dinner awaits.
Headings Cliffs to Paringa
The dawn chorus and aromas of great coffee raise you from your sleep. Enjoy breakfast on the houseboat as the sunlight on the cliffs is reflected in the mirror-like surface of the river. After breakfast you can explore the riverbank and the native plants on your island home. Gather your thoughts and record your inspirations during a leisurely cruise on the houseboat to the innovative Wilkadene Woolshed Brewery.
Meet the head brewer and enjoy a tour and tasting before savouring a lunch prepared by your guides. Then we say our farewells as you depart to Renmark town for transfers further afield.
